Psalm 127:1 says: “Unless the Lord watches over the city, the watchman stays awake in vain.”In this episode (Part 2 of our Psalm 127 series), we unpack what it really means to trust God as our Protector—at home, in marriage, and in business.
We talk about natural protective instincts (dads scanning rooms, moms in “mama bear” mode), the limits of human control, and how to practice wisdom without worshiping “safety.” You’ll learn a simple framework to move from fear and overstriving to faith and surrender, so your watchfulness serves God’s will rather than replacing it.
You’ll learn:
* What “watchman” means in Psalm 127:1—and how it applies today
* The difference between wise precautions and vain striving
* How to trust God’s protection when you can’t be everywhere
* A practical rhythm for dependence: pray, plan, work… and rest
* Why Colossians 3:23–24 reframes your daily work and decisions
